Installer AlloyDB Omni

Sélectionnez une version de la documentation :

Ce guide de démarrage rapide vous explique comment installer AlloyDB Omni, qui peut s'exécuter dans n'importe quel environnement UNIX compatible avec les runtimes de conteneurs.

Pour obtenir une présentation d'AlloyDB Omni, consultez Présentation d'AlloyDB Omni.

Avant de commencer

Le tableau suivant liste la configuration matérielle et logicielle minimale requise pour AlloyDB Omni.

OS/Plate-forme Configuration matérielle minimale Logiciel minimum
Linux
  • Processeur x86-64 ou Arm (*) avec prise en charge AVX2
  • 2 Go de RAM
  • 10 Go d'espace disque
  • OS basé sur Debian (Ubuntu, etc.) RHEL 8 ou 9
  • Version 5.3 ou ultérieure du noyau Linux
  • Cgroupsv2 activé
  • Docker Engine 20.10+ ou Podman 4.2.0+
  • macOS
  • Processeur Intel compatible avec AVX2 ou puce M
  • 2 Go de RAM
  • 10 Go d'espace disque
  • Docker Desktop 4.20 ou version ultérieure
  • (*) La compatibilité avec Arm est disponible en preview.

    AlloyDB Omni s'exécute dans un conteneur. Installez un environnement d'exécution de conteneur tel que Docker ou Podman sur votre machine avant d'installer AlloyDB Omni.

    Installer AlloyDB Omni à l'aide de Docker

    Docker

    1. Utilisez la commande docker run pour créer un conteneur avec AlloyDB Omni nommé my-omni :

        docker run --name my-omni \
          -e POSTGRES_PASSWORD=NEW_PASSWORD \
          -d google/alloydbomni:15

      Remplacez NEW_PASSWORD par un mot de passe pour attribuer le nouvel utilisateur postgres du conteneur après sa création.

    2. Connectez-vous à AlloyDB Omni conteneurisé à l'aide de psql :

        docker exec -it my-omni psql -h localhost -U postgres

      La fenêtre du terminal affiche le texte de connexion psql qui se termine par une invite postgres=#.

    Podman

    1. Utilisez la commande docker run pour créer un conteneur avec AlloyDB Omni nommé my-omni :

        podman run --name my-omni \
          -e POSTGRES_PASSWORD=NEW_PASSWORD \
          -d google/alloydbomni:15

      Remplacez NEW_PASSWORD par un mot de passe pour attribuer le nouvel utilisateur postgres du conteneur après sa création.

    2. Connectez-vous à AlloyDB Omni conteneurisé à l'aide de psql :

      podman exec -it my-omni psql -h localhost -U postgres

      La fenêtre du terminal affiche le texte de connexion psql qui se termine par une invite postgres=#.

    Effectuer un nettoyage

    Pour nettoyer le conteneur AlloyDB Omni que vous avez créé dans ce guide de démarrage rapide, procédez comme suit :

    Docker

    1. Arrêtez votre conteneur AlloyDB Omni nommé my-omni :

        docker container stop my-omni
    2. Supprimez votre conteneur AlloyDB Omni nommé my-omni :

        docker container rm my-omni

    Podman

    1. Arrêtez votre conteneur AlloyDB Omni nommé my-omni :

        podman container stop my-omni
    2. Supprimez votre conteneur AlloyDB Omni nommé my-omni :

        podman container rm my-omni

    Pour savoir comment installer AlloyDB Omni dans un nouveau conteneur pour une utilisation en production, consultez la page Personnaliser votre installation AlloyDB Omni.

    Étapes suivantes